What will the weather in Hayters Hill be like during my visit?
January and February are typically the warmest months in Hayters Hill, when the average temperature is 23°C. July and August are the coldest months, when the average temperature is 16°C. March and February are the months with the most rain.

Top locations to stay in Hayters Hill

Some of the best areas to stay in when visiting Hayters Hill, New South Wales, are Byron Bay, Brunswick Heads, and Bangalow. Byron Bay offers stunning beaches and vibrant surf culture, Brunswick Heads boasts charming riverside scenery, and Bangalow features a relaxed atmosphere with quaint shops. For first-time visitors, Byron Bay is the ideal choice for its lively vibe and attractions.

  1. Byron BayOpens in a new window: Byron Bay is a vibrant coastal paradise known for its stunning beaches and laid-back atmosphere. It’s a fantastic spot for sunbathing, surfing, and soaking in the beautiful coastal scenery. The iconic Cape Byron Lighthouse offers breathtaking views and is a must-see for anyone visiting. Beyond the beach, you can explore the local arts scene, with plenty of galleries and cultural events. The town is also famous for its markets, where you can find local crafts and tasty treats. With a lively community and plenty of wellness retreats, Byron Bay is perfect for those looking to relax and recharge.
  2. Brunswick HeadsOpens in a new window: Just a short drive from Byron Bay, Brunswick Heads is a charming riverside village that offers a more tranquil escape. Known for its stunning river views and quaint atmosphere, it’s ideal for those who enjoy kayaking, fishing, or simply lounging by the water. The local shops and cafes add to the village's charm, and the nearby beaches are perfect for a peaceful day out. With beautiful nature reserves and walking tracks, Brunswick Heads provides a lovely blend of relaxation and natural beauty.
  3. BangalowOpens in a new window: Bangalow is a picturesque hinterland village that’s perfect for those seeking a relaxing retreat. The area boasts beautiful historic buildings and a vibrant local market that showcases artisan goods and fresh produce. Bangalow is surrounded by lush green hills, making it a great spot for scenic walks and nature appreciation. The local cafes offer delicious food and a friendly atmosphere, making it a lovely place to unwind and enjoy the slower pace of life.

  • Wategos BeachOpens in a new window – Discover the serene beauty of Wategos Beach, a peaceful spot perfect for sunbathing or a leisurely swim. The calm waters are ideal for families and those looking to relax by the ocean, while the surrounding cliffs offer stunning views and a sense of seclusion.
  • Main BeachOpens in a new window – Head to Main Beach for a vibrant atmosphere filled with surfers and beachgoers. This lively stretch of sand is perfect for beach sports, soaking up the sun, or enjoying a picnic with friends and family. The nearby cafes offer delicious refreshments to keep you energised.
  • Cape Byron LighthouseOpens in a new window – Climb up to the iconic Cape Byron Lighthouse, a historic landmark that stands proudly on the easternmost point of Australia. Enjoy panoramic views of the coastline and the ocean; it's a fantastic spot for photos, especially at sunrise or sunset.
  • Clarkes BeachOpens in a new window – Visit Clarkes Beach, where soft sands and gentle waves create an inviting environment for swimming and sunbathing. It's also a great starting point for coastal walks and exploring the lush landscapes that surround the area.
  • Crystal Castle & Shambhala GardensOpens in a new window – Explore the enchanting Crystal Castle & Shambhala Gardens, where stunning gardens filled with crystals and sculptures create a tranquil oasis. Take a leisurely stroll through the paths, admire the unique artworks, and soak in the serene atmosphere.

Best time to go to Hayters Hill

Hayters Hill experiences its lowest average temperature in July, at 59.5°F (15.3°C), while January is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 74.7°F (23.7°C). March is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Hayters Hill, January, October, and December are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, with light r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, May, June, and August are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
